(a)To be eligible to participate in the program, a person shall meet all of the requirements in either paragraph (1) or (2):
(1)
(A)Be pregnant or in the postpartum period as specified in Section 15840 and a resident of the state. A person who is a member of a federally recognized California Indian tribe is a resident of the state for these purposes.
(B)Have a household income that is above 208 percent of the official federal poverty level but does not exceed 317 percent of the official federal poverty level.
